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93136 7247513560 5580514 553274 98
56889 45690806 8425195
56889 45690806 8425195
57 9350779 8928
All about undefined
Interested in learning more?
56889 45690806 8425195
57 9350779 8928
See more
2336549152 722 4121619
0648989 11 8961998
See more
815555844 99
7257 239 38508382526
See more